Been There for Self Care: IV Drip

April 22, 2021 Jenna Valentine
IV Vitamin Drip

IV Vitamin Drip

I think IV drips are so cool because you can get a ton of vitamins, minerals and nutrients without relying on your digestive system. It just feels so darn efficient. This efficiency combined with an awesome atmosphere and fantastic humans is why I love MSW Vitamin Lounge so much. The owners have created a true wellness space with an unpretentious and casual vibe that is based on holistic health. There are always interesting people to meet there and their ‘lunch and learns’ feature awesome topics.

The way it works is super simple: you book your appointment online or over the phone, wear whatever you want that leaves your inner elbow exposed for IV needle insertion, and consider bringing a book to read as the drip can take 30ish minutes depending on how greedy your body is feeling.

There are comfy couches, the IV needle is flexible so you don’t feel like your arm is stuck in one position, and the whole atmosphere is like you’re in a super healthy friend’s really clean living room doing health things together.

You choose the IV you’re feeling or let the dealer choose and then get comfy, get the IV inserted and chill. Once the IV drop bag is empty they remove all the things, put a little gauze on your arm and you’re off to rock the rest of your day.

Sometimes there can be a weird taste in your mouth if you’re getting a fair amount of B12, sometimes your pee will be electric yellow or smellier after a B complex (usually B2 is the culprit if I remember correctly), sometimes there can be a bit of really minor stinging at the insertion site if there is high dosed vitamin C, but there than that this is simple, awesome and a sweet way to treat your body.
